Japan’s market for titanium-based material porous filters segmented by application shows diverse usage across several key sectors. In water filtration, these filters are crucial for purifying industrial and residential water sources, ensuring high purity levels suitable for various applications. Chemical processing applications utilize titanium-based porous filters for their corrosion resistance and durability, facilitating efficient separation and filtration processes.
Medical and pharmaceutical industries in Japan rely on these filters for their biocompatibility and ability to withstand sterilization processes, crucial for ensuring the safety and purity of pharmaceutical products and medical devices. In aerospace and defense, titanium-based porous filters contribute to air and fluid filtration systems, enhancing operational efficiency and safety in critical environments. The energy sector utilizes these filters in applications ranging from nuclear power plants to renewable energy systems, leveraging their robustness and resistance to harsh operating conditions.
